Grote spelers op de ict-markt bouwen samen een XML-standaard voor betrouwbare uitwisseling en coördinatie van geautomatiseerde bedrijfstransacties.
De noodklok over een woud aan XML-varianten klinkt weer iets gedempter. Analist David Potterton van Meridian Research klaagde enkele weken geleden nog dat de industrie een potje dreigt te maken van XML. De platform-onafhankelijkheid van deze taal is in het geding. Potterton klaagde erover dat elk bedrijf zijn eigen XML-variant aan het maken is.
De aankondiging van IBM, HP, Oracle, Sun en Bowstreet.com logenstraft dit pessimisme. De bedrijven werken hand in hand aan Xaml (Transaction Authority Markup Language): een platform-onafhankelijke standaard die ervoor zorgt dat bedrijfstransacties via Internet inderdaad worden uitgevoerd (verzekerde routering) en dat er onderweg niks mis gaat met de inhoud van de transacties (betrouwbare levering van berichten). De ondernemingen streven ernaar binnen zes maanden een protocol te hebben ontwikkeld. Dit wordt dan voorgelegd aan standaardencommissies als W3C, Organization for the Advancement of Structured Information Standards (Oasis) en de Ietf.
Opvallende afwezige is Microsoft, dat enige tijd geleden met zijn .Net-strategie eveneens de stap heeft gezet naar het mogelijk maken van handel via Internet-diensten. Microsoft was niet bereikbaar voor commentaar. De Xaml-partners zeggen evenwel dat Big Green van harte welkom is mee te sleutelen aan de standaard.
IBM gaat zijn technologie van en ervaring met MQ-series (middleware) inbrengen. HP komt met zijn eSpeak-interfaces en api’s in het boodschappenmandje. Dit zijn eveneens specificaties waarlangs men via het multi-pluriforme platform Internet-berichten betrouwbaar kan uitwisselen. Hetzelfde geldt voor Websphere van IBM. De twee firma’s bundelen kennis en ervaring binnen de te ontwikkelen Xaml-standaard.
Bowstreet.com op zijn beurt brengt zijn kunde in voor het ontwikkelen van sterk schaalbare componenten voor web-diensten die op XML zijn gebaseerd. Bowstreet gebruikt zijn ‘parametrische technologie’ om te bepalen welke datarun time moeten worden verwerkt om verstopping of plat gaan van de server te voorkomen.
Xaml, zo verzekeren de initiatiefnemers, is een aanvulling op Uddi (Universal Description, Discovery and Integration), dat IBM, Microsoft en Ariba aan het ontwikkelen zijn. Uddi is een poging om Internet-handel te structuren (ongeveer in de trant Edifact). Uddi moet een gids opleveren waarin te zien is wie de partijen zijn die via Internet handel bedrijven, terwijl Xaml de middelen moet verschaffen om die handel dan ook veilig af te werken.